Thor Fagerström

Pyraminx · top 1.5% of 129,321 all-time · competing since October 2022 · 2022FAGE01

Thor Fagerström has been competing for 4 years. His best event is the Pyraminx: a personal-best single of 2.18, set at Ugnsbakad Falukorv Open 2026, puts him in the top 1.5% of the 129,321 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 51st in Sweden. Until July 2011, no official Pyraminx solve in the world had been that fast. Across 29 competitions since October 2022, he has put 1,704 official solves on the record across 14 events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one, steadier than 52%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. His 3×3 best has come down from 26.77 in March 2023 to 7.90, a 70% improvement. Thor has entered 29 competitions, more competitions than 98% of everyone who has ever competed.
